Property of Lite-On Only ABSOLUTE MAXIMUM RATINGS AT TA=25 PARAMETER MAXIMUM RATING UNIT Power Dissipation 75 mW Peak Forward Current (300pps, 10s pulse) 1 A Continuous Forward Current 50 mA Reverse Voltage 5 V Operating Temperature Range -40 to + 85 Storage Temperature Range -55 to + 100 Lead Soldering Temperature [1.6mm(.063") From Body] 260 for 5 Seconds ELECTRICAL OPTICAL CHARACTERISTICS AT TA=25 PARAMETER SYMBOL MIN.
